Ingredients

To prepare this grilled chicken salad with nuts and seeds, use fresh, high-quality ingredients. They ensure a healthy salad that is colorful, high in protein, and full of flavor.

For the chicken

  • 2 skinless, boneless chicken breasts

  • 1 tablespoon olive oil

  • 1 teaspoon paprika

  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der

  • Salt to taste

  • Black pepper to taste

For the salad

  • 4 cups mixed lettuce leaves (iceberg, curly, romaine, or butter lettuce)

  • ½ cup cooked quinoa

  • ½ cucumber, sliced

  • 1 small yellow tomato, sliced, or cherry tomatoes

  • ¼ cup chopped walnuts

  • 2 tablespoons pumpkin seeds

  • 1 tablespoon sesame seeds (optional)

  • 2 tablespoons dried cranberries (optional)

For the homemade dressing

  • 3 tablespoons olive oil

  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ice

  • 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ard

  • 1 teaspoon honey

  • Salt to taste

  • Black pepper to taste

Equipment

  • Skillet or grill pan

  • Large bowl

  • Small bowl

  • Sharp knife

  • Cutting board

  • Whisk or fork

Instructions

1. Season the chicken

Pat the chicken breasts dry with paper towels. Mix the olive oil, paprika, garlic powder, salt, and black pepper. Spread this mixture evenly over the entire surface of the chicken so it absorbs the seasonings well.

2. Grill the chicken

Heat a skillet or grill pan over medium-high heat. Place the chicken breasts on the hot surface and grill until they are golden brown on the outside and fully cooked on the inside. Once cooked, let them rest for a few minutes before slicing them into strips. This process helps keep the chicken juicier.

3. Prepare the salad base

In a large bowl, add the lettuce leaves, cooked quinoa, sliced cucumber, and tomato. Toss gently to distribute the ingredients evenly.

4. Add the nuts and seeds

Add the chopped walnuts, pumpkin seeds, sesame seeds, and dried cranberries. These ingredients make the chicken quinoa salad even more nutritious, providing a delicious combination of flavors and textures.

5. Prepare the dressing

Mix the olive oil, lemon juice, Dijon mustard, honey, salt, and black pepper until you have a smooth and slightly creamy dressing.

6. Assemble the salad

Arrange the grilled chicken strips over the salad and drizzle with the homemade dressing just before serving. This way, the lettuce stays fresh and crisp, creating a fitness salad, a high-protein salad, and the perfect choice for a healthy lunch, light dinner, or healthy meal prep.

Tips for the Perfect Grilled Chicken Salad

  • Let the chicken rest for a few minutes before slicing to preserve its juiciness.

  • Use thoroughly washed and dried greens so the dressing is distributed evenly over the ingredients.

  • The quinoa should be completely cooled before adding it to the salad.

  • Lightly toast the walnuts and seeds in a dry skillet to enhance their flavor and make them even crispier.

  • Drizzle the grilled chicken salad with the dressing only just before serving to keep the greens fresh.

How to Store

Store the salad and the dressing in separate containers to preserve the texture of the ingredients.

  • In the refrigerator: up to 3 days.

  • The dressing should be added only just before serving.

  • The grilled chicken can be stored separately for up to 3 days in a sealed container.

Freezing is not recommended, as the greens and fresh vegetables lose their texture after thawing.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I prepare this salad ahead of time?

Yes. Prepare all the ingredients separately and assemble the salad only when ready to serve. This is an excellent option for a healthy meal prep lunch for work or college.

Can I cook the chicken in the air fryer?

Yes. Season it as usual and cook it in the air fryer until it is golden on the outside and fully cooked on the inside.

Is this recipe gluten-free?

Yes, as long as the Dijon mustard and any other processed ingredients used are certified gluten-free.

Can I use another type of nut?

Yes. Almonds, cashews, Brazil nuts, and pecans also pair very well with this grilled chicken salad with walnuts and seeds.
